import os | |
import shutil | |
import zipfile | |
from pcbnew import * | |
layers = { | |
"GTL":F_Cu, | |
"GBL":B_Cu, | |
"GTO":F_SilkS, | |
"GBO":B_SilkS, | |
"GTS":F_Mask, | |
"GBS":B_Mask, | |
"GML":Edge_Cuts, | |
} | |
def convert() : | |
board = GetBoard() | |
plot_controller = PLOT_CONTROLLER(board) | |
plot_options = plot_controller.GetPlotOptions() | |
excellon_writer = EXCELLON_WRITER(board) | |
board_basename = os.path.basename(board.GetFileName()).split('.')[0] | |
pcb_dirname = "{}_switchsience_pcb".format(board_basename) | |
print "board_basename:", board_basename | |
print "pcb_dirname:", pcb_dirname | |
#GERBER OUTPUT | |
# Options | |
plot_options.SetFormat(PLOT_FORMAT_GERBER) | |
plot_options.SetOutputDirectory(pcb_dirname) | |
plot_options.SetPlotFrameRef(False) | |
plot_options.SetPlotPadsOnSilkLayer(False) | |
plot_options.SetPlotValue(True) | |
plot_options.SetPlotReference(True) | |
plot_options.SetPlotInvisibleText(False) | |
plot_options.SetPlotViaOnMaskLayer(False) | |
plot_options.SetExcludeEdgeLayer(False) | |
plot_options.SetUseAuxOrigin(False) | |
plot_options.SetLineWidth(FromMM(0.1)) | |
plot_options.SetUseGerberProtelExtensions(False) | |
plot_options.SetUseGerberAttributes(False) | |
plot_options.SetSubtractMaskFromSilk(False) | |
# Export, Rename | |
for (ext, sym) in layers.items() : | |
plot_controller.OpenPlotfile("", PLOT_FORMAT_GERBER, "") | |
plot_controller.SetLayer(sym) | |
plot_controller.PlotLayer() | |
pcb_dirpath = plot_controller.GetPlotDirName() | |
gerber_raw_filepath = plot_controller.GetPlotFileName() | |
gerber_filepath = os.path.join(pcb_dirpath, "{}.{}".format(board_basename, ext)) | |
print "gerber_filepath:", gerber_filepath | |
shutil.move(gerber_raw_filepath, gerber_filepath) | |
plot_controller.ClosePlot() | |
#DRILL OUTPUT | |
# Options | |
excellon_writer.SetFormat(True, EXCELLON_WRITER.DECIMAL_FORMAT, 3, 3) | |
excellon_writer.SetOptions(False, False, wxPoint(0, 0), True) | |
excellon_writer.CreateDrillandMapFilesSet(pcb_dirpath, True, False) | |
# Export, Rename | |
drill_raw_filepath = os.path.join(pcb_dirpath, "{}.drl".format(board_basename)) | |
drill_filepath = os.path.join(pcb_dirpath, "{}.TXT".format(board_basename)) | |
print "drill_filepath:", drill_filepath | |
shutil.move(drill_raw_filepath, drill_filepath) | |
#Build ZIP | |
pcb_zipfilepath = "{}.zip".format(pcb_dirpath[:-1]) | |
print "pcb_zipfilepath:", pcb_zipfilepath | |
with zipfile.ZipFile(pcb_zipfilepath, 'w') as zip_f : | |
#GERBER | |
for (ext, sym) in layers.items() : | |
gerber_filepath = os.path.join(pcb_dirpath, "{}.{}".format(board_basename, ext)) | |
gerber_filename = os.path.join(pcb_dirname, "{}.{}".format(board_basename, ext)) | |
zip_f.write(gerber_filepath, gerber_filename) | |
#DRILL | |
drill_filepath = os.path.join(pcb_dirpath, "{}.TXT".format(board_basename)) | |
drill_filename = os.path.join(pcb_dirname, "{}.TXT".format(board_basename)) | |
zip_f.write(drill_filepath, drill_filename) | |
print "success" |
